Caméra d’or jury member Emmanuelle Béart has been having fun and games with suits and shirts at this year’s festival. Best known for her portrayal of IMF agent Claire Phelps in the 1996 Hollywood hit Mission: Impossible, the French actor’s Dior look, complete with upside down shirt, deserves special mention here. As do the action hero glasses.
Photograph: Doug Peters/PA Wearing one of a host of overtly crinkled dresses that dodged the iron this week in Cannes, Greta Gerwig attended the premiere of L’Amour ouf in this hot-pink Balenciaga couture gown. There was always going to be at least one pink look from the Barbie director who, as jury president, is required to attend almost 70 premieres. The look was completed with armpit-length black opera gloves.
Photograph: Daniel Cole/Invision/AP Earlier in the day, Bella Hadid had stepped out for a sorbet in a dress made entirely of red and white keffiyehs , in a show of solidarity with Palestine. On the red carpet later, she wore this archival Atelier Versace for the premier of L’Amour ouf (Beating Hearts). The supermodel has worn several vintage looks at this year’s festival, proving designer pieces from down the years can more than hold their own on the red carpet.
